You’ll be happy to know that there is a site that offers its services in analyzing your resume and giving it a grade. It’s called RezScore, and it’s becoming very popular among jobseekers who want to know if they made the grade, so to speak.

You just have to upload your resume into the site, and RezScore will immediately give you a grade based on their analysis of your resume. They use a complicated mathematical algorithm that basically compares your resume to their collection of “A” resumes, as well as some analysis of other factors such as the average word and sentence length you use, the sentence to experience ration, the overall length of the resume, the language and sentence structure you use, and the grade level of your writing.

The grading is actually free, and it comes with a couple of tips to help you improve your resume. For a reasonable fee, you can also avail of the RezScore Makeover of your resume, where they will do an in-depth analysis of your resume, fix and improve your grammar and word choices, edit your formatting and presentation, and even help you craft your headline so it’s better and more attention-grabbing.
